Pra Group Inc Up 2.83% To $38.55 After Earnings Beat

Tuesday, August 9, 2022 - Pra Group Inc (PRAA) reported upside earnings and revenues today.

Pra Group Inc's earnings came in at an EPS of $0.91 per share, 69.00% higher than estimates for an EPS of $0.54 per share. The firm's earnings are down 25% since reporting $1.22 per share in the same period a year ago. Remember, earnings reported were on an adjusted basis, so they may not be comparable to prior reports and/or analyst estimates.

Revenues were upbeat at $258.3 million. That represents a 9.58% decrease in revenues from the year-ago report and is 10.38% higher than consensus estimates set at $234 million.

The stock is up 2.83% to $38.55 after the report.

Pra Group Inc's profit margins took a hit as earnings fell at a faster pace than revenues.

PRA Group Inc is a company that primarily acquires, collects, and processes nonperforming loans in the Americas and Europe. The accounts acquired by the company are unpaid obligations of individuals owed to credit grantors, which primarily include banks and other types of consumer, retail, and auto finance companies It acquires portfolios of nonperforming loans in two categories: Core and Insolvency. The company generates the majority of its sales from the United States.
